Preview Mode Links will not work in preview mode

Grant Lawrence Superfeed


May 29, 2019

Hermit of Desolation Sound is Grant Lawrence's latest true life adventure series, starring Russell Letawsky, the hermit philosopher who lived off the grid in a dank shack on West Coast of Canada for over a decade.